The overview below groups typical Shingle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Itasca,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Average Cost Range - Shingle repair services typically cost between $300 and $1,200, depending on the extent of damage. For example, replacing a few damaged shingles might be around $300, while extensive repairs could approach $1,200.
Per-Shingle Pricing - Many providers charge between $20 and $50 per shingle for repairs. This cost varies based on shingle type and the complexity of access to the roof area.
Material and Labor Factors - The overall cost can fluctuate based on the type of shingles used and the labor involved, with repairs for high-quality materials often costing more. Typical expenses for materials and labor combined range from $400 to $1,500.
Cost Influences - Factors such as roof size, pitch, and accessibility influence repair costs. Smaller repairs in accessible areas may be closer to $200, while larger or more complex projects can exceed $2,000.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my shingles need repair? Signs like missing, cracked, or curling shingles, as well as leaks or water stains on ceilings, indicate potential damage requiring professional assessment.
What causes shingle damage over time? Exposure to severe weather, wind, hail, and the natural aging process can lead to shingle deterioration and the need for repairs.
Can I repair shingles myself? Shingle repairs typically require specialized tools and expertise; it is recommended to contact local professionals for safe and effective repairs.
How long do shingle repairs usually take? The duration depends on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a day by experienced service providers.
